I have a wallet.dat with a password. The password for some reason does not compatible in bitcoin core When checking the hash with hashcat, my password is suitable. 
Why wallet.dat password is not compatible in bitcoin core?
You probably have a hacked/modified wallet. Is it yours?
Have you tries to import .wallet file in bitcoin core first?